Through Pitt's partnership with Care.com, eligible employees not only get a network of providers and options to assist with care needs such as after-school care, caring for a child who is home sick, caring for children while you are working from home, and caring for aging parents, you also gain access to dozens of live and on-demand hour-long webinars to help you navigate life. Care Talks, available at no cost to you, are expert-led webinars that can help you thrive in all areas of life—personally, professionally, and everything in between.
Topics areas for the seven Care Talks sessions offered every month include:
- Aging and adult care
Gain knowledge to help support your aging loved ones and navigate the challenges that come with aging.
- Child care and parenting
Gain insights and learn strategies to help raise healthy and well-rounded children.
- Navigating disabilities
Get support and guidance on how to raise a child or care for a loved one with a disability.
- Emotional wellness
Learn tips and techniques to manage stress and navigate life’s challenges.
- Financial wellness
Explore strategies for planning your financial future and managing money to meet your goals.
- Success at work
Learn strategies to improve your skills, advance your career, adapt to workplace change, and perform to your potential.
- Your healthy lifestyle
Get guidance and support from lifestyle experts to help you feel your best.
All Care Talks take place at 1 p.m. ET on their scheduled date. For a list of all workshops being presented in 2026, download this flyer, or visit the Human Resources Calendar of Events.
To register for any workshop, you must first enroll in your free Care Benefits account. Visit Care.com to enroll (note: you will need to provide your six-digit employee number, located on your Panther ID card or your employee payslip in Pitt Worx).
Once enrolled, navigate to their Care Talks page and browse the available webinar offerings. See one you'd like to attend? Click the Register button on any offering to sign up. That's it! You'll receive an invite from Zoom via email to add your Care Talk to your calendar.
You can also find an archive of on-demand sessions by scrolling down the Care Talks page to the "Recorded Care Talks" section. We hope you find these sessions useful and rewarding.
